diff options
Diffstat (limited to 'xbmc/addons/kodi-addon-dev-kit/include/kodi/xbmc_addon_dll.h')
| -rw-r--r-- | xbmc/addons/kodi-addon-dev-kit/include/kodi/xbmc_addon_dll.h | 5 |
1 files changed, 5 insertions, 0 deletions
diff --git a/xbmc/addons/kodi-addon-dev-kit/include/kodi/xbmc_addon_dll.h b/xbmc/addons/kodi-addon-dev-kit/include/kodi/xbmc_addon_dll.h index e9e7d9a..ce2bc98 100644 --- a/xbmc/addons/kodi-addon-dev-kit/include/kodi/xbmc_addon_dll.h +++ b/xbmc/addons/kodi-addon-dev-kit/include/kodi/xbmc_addon_dll.h | |||
| @@ -15,6 +15,7 @@ extern "C" { | |||
| 15 | #endif | 15 | #endif |
| 16 | 16 | ||
| 17 | ADDON_STATUS __declspec(dllexport) ADDON_Create(void *callbacks, void* props); | 17 | ADDON_STATUS __declspec(dllexport) ADDON_Create(void *callbacks, void* props); |
| 18 | ADDON_STATUS __declspec(dllexport) ADDON_CreateEx(void *callbacks, const char* globalApiVersion, void* props); | ||
| 18 | void __declspec(dllexport) ADDON_Destroy(); | 19 | void __declspec(dllexport) ADDON_Destroy(); |
| 19 | ADDON_STATUS __declspec(dllexport) ADDON_GetStatus(); | 20 | ADDON_STATUS __declspec(dllexport) ADDON_GetStatus(); |
| 20 | ADDON_STATUS __declspec(dllexport) ADDON_SetSetting(const char *settingName, const void *settingValue); | 21 | ADDON_STATUS __declspec(dllexport) ADDON_SetSetting(const char *settingName, const void *settingValue); |
| @@ -22,6 +23,10 @@ extern "C" { | |||
| 22 | { | 23 | { |
| 23 | return kodi::addon::GetTypeVersion(type); | 24 | return kodi::addon::GetTypeVersion(type); |
| 24 | } | 25 | } |
| 26 | __declspec(dllexport) const char* ADDON_GetTypeMinVersion(int type) | ||
| 27 | { | ||
| 28 | return kodi::addon::GetTypeMinVersion(type); | ||
| 29 | } | ||
| 25 | 30 | ||
| 26 | #ifdef __cplusplus | 31 | #ifdef __cplusplus |
| 27 | }; | 32 | }; |
